MRS. WILLIAM PAUL (.'II AM-
HKRS, the former Mis.s Fay Sher
rill, daughter of Mr. and Mrs.'
Clarence Sherrill, of Waynesville,'
R.F.D. No. 2, whose marriage took j
place in Greenville, S. C, at 2 '
iclock Friday afternoon, August
18th. ' jt
Pfc. Chambers, her husband, son
of Mrs. Esther Chambers, of Clyde,
recently returned from overseas
where he served in the 1 acihe war
theatre for two years and eight
months. He volunteered for ser
vice on September 16, 1939. At
the present the couple are residing
with the bridegroom's mother in
Clvde.
